首页 > 文章列表 > 云服务器 > 正文

计算机常识纠正:APL、J和Dyalog的区别揭秘

是一篇文章或者指南,旨在帮助用户更好地了解这三种编程语言之间的区别,并帮助他们选择适合自己需求的语言。

这三种语言都是面向数组的编程语言,但在语法、功能和性能上都有所不同。

首先,让我们来比较一下APL、J和Dyalog这三种语言的优点和缺点。

优点:

1. APL是一种直观的编程语言,使用特殊的符号来表示数学运算,非常适合处理数学和统计学问题。

2. J是一种高效的编程语言,具有强大的数组处理能力,适合处理大规模数据和复杂算法。

3. Dyalog是一种现代化的编程语言,具有丰富的库和工具支持,适合开发各种类型的应用程序。

缺点:

1. APL的特殊符号和语法使得代码难以阅读和理解,对于初学者来说学习曲线较陡。http://5rmfrk.cn2008machine.com/nthy/sbc.html

2. J的语法虽然简洁高效,但对于一些传统编程语言的用户来说可能有一定的学习困难。

接下来,让我们分享一些使用这三种语言时的技巧,帮助用户避免常见问题:

1. 熟练掌握每种语言的基本语法和特殊符号,这有助于更快地编写和理解代码。

2. 使用文档和在线资源来解决遇到的问题,这样可以节省时间并提高效率。

3. 经常练习编写简单的代码片段和小型项目,以加深对语言的理解和掌握。

最后,为什么值得使用这三种语言呢?因为它们各自具有独特的优点,在不同领域和场景下都能发挥作用。

无论是数学建模、数据分析还是软件开发,APL、J和Dyalog都能为用户提供强大的编程工具和解决方案。

只要用户掌握了这些语言的基本知识,就能在编程世界中游刃有余地应对挑战。

问答方式:

Q: APL、J和Dyalog这三种语言分别适用于哪些领域?

A: APL适合处理数学和统计学问题,J适合处理大规模数据和复杂算法,Dyalog适合开发各种类型的应用程序。

Q: 有没有什么技巧可以帮助用户更好地使用这三种语言?

A: 用户可以熟练掌握基本语法和特殊符号,使用文档和在线资源解决问题,经常练习编写代码片段和小型项目来提高技能水平。

分享文章

微博
QQ
QQ空间
复制链接
操作成功
顶部
底部